Pet's info: Dog | American Pit Bull Terrier | Female | spayed | 70 lbs
Dog just ate some tree lichen a few minutes ago, it wasnt a lot, just wondering if I should be concerned. I tried to get it out of her mouth, but she ran and swallowed it. This is the kind it looked like.

That was naughty of Daedra to eat that tree lichen! This lichen is likely fungus, and while most types of fungi are mildly or non toxic, there are some kinds that can cause severe symptoms such as vomiting, diarrhea, lack of appetite, and abdominal pain. You could take her into a vet now to have vomiting induced with a shot to get the lichen out of her stomach and take away any risk of toxicity. You can also choose to monitor her over the next 24-48 hours, and if you see any of the symptoms I mentioned above, take her into a vet immediately for treatment. I hope this helps!
